#15776d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15776d is composed of 8.2% red, 46.7%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 173.9 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 27.5%. #15776d color hex could be obtained by blending #2aeeda with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#15776d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15776d has RGB values of R:21, G:119,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1406829.

Shades and Tints of #15776d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#f1f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#15776d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454746 is the less saturated color, while #05877a is the most saturated one.
